As the International Monetary Fund (IMF) praises the UK government for its “bold and wide-ranging” response in containing the economic downturn, commercial recruiters are seeing signs of an improvement in hiring intentions.

Leah Clifford, consultant at TopType Personnel, told Recruiter: “I still think it is quiet. There has been a slight pick-up in private sector roles. I feel like we have a lot more in a pipeline. When we are talking to clients, there is a lot more positivity in the marketplace.

“Clients are saying’ nothing is going to happen yet, but call me back later this month because there might be something in the pipeline’. The intention is there but the confidence is not.”

Kirsty Miall, director at Attic Recruitment, adds: “The more that we read there are green shoots, people will have confidence in the market place. We have found that a lot of our executive search clients are staring to hire at the very senior level and that filters down to us.”
